Nadir

Tabled all my thoughts to keep them empty Walked alone to make the voices die Never thought pebbles would make waves that crested over all the sunlight and brought my hopes down with the colors of the sky Nothing there to balance what is spinning I cannot let the phantoms gain control My pulse quickens as the chaos starts to envelope all the silence Can't make the pieces come together as a whole
